Lead Product Designer

Company Description

Ribbiot combines the latest IoT tracking devices with cutting-edge software technologies to manage workflows and track equipment. We're creating an intuitive, cloud-based application to improve businesses' ability to schedule, maintain, and deploy complex equipment configurations. Ribbiot seamlessly transforms existing processes into digital workflows and allows customers to digitally interact with their physical equipment while collecting data, deriving insights, and improving the efficiency of operations.

Position Summary

As Lead Product Designer at Ribbiot, you will have the opportunity to be part of a revolutionary team that is transforming the way businesses manage their equipment and workflows. You’ll have the chance to help shape our cloud-based platform that simplifies and digitizes existing complex operations, so customers can interact with their physical equipment more easily. You will work closely with Product Management to help define feature requirements, create user flows & interfaces, and coordinate closely with Engineering to ensure concepts are clearly communicated, understood, and properly implemented.

Responsibilities

  • Leading UX and UI Design for Ribbiot’s IoT product offerings – creating personas, workflows, interaction models, and hifi mocks to define the end-to-end user experience for Ribbiot product offerings
  • Working closely with Product Management to identify user needs, define feature requirements, and deliver solutions that meet business and user needs
  • Conducting user interviews to gather input and collect feedback throughout the design process
  • Coordinating with Software Engineering to understand the technical requirements, constraints, and complexities
  • Collaborating with leads across disciplines to clearly communicate design concepts and design intent
  • Mentoring and educating cross-functionally on design processes, practices, and rationale

Skills and Qualifications

  • 7+ years’ experience designing interfaces and experiences for software products
  • Bachelor’s or Graduate degree in Interaction Design, Graphic Design, HCI, or equivalent professional experience
  • A portfolio demonstrating end-to-end design process and problem solving (applicants without a portfolio will not be considered)
  • A strong aesthetic and visual design sense, with the ability to create visually compelling designs that engage and delight users
  • Extensive experience with user-centered design practices at every stage of the design process
  • Ability to analyze and distill technically complex problems into simple, easy-to-use design solutions
  • Experience conducting user interviews to gather input and feedback to validate proposed design solutions
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to clearly and succinctly communicate problems and solutions to key stakeholders across disciplines
  • Experience facilitating workshops, brainstorming, and design working sessions across functions

The ideal candidate will additionally possess the following

  • Prior experience working with agile methodologies in a startup environment
  • Demonstrated ability to translate abstract requirements into concrete specifications and feature definitions
  • Experience designing solutions for connected devices and IoT products
  • Experience designing low-code/no-code solutions
  • Experience with spatial design and/or working on AR applications
  • Knowledge of H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ript and other programming languages
  • Familiarity with backend systems (databases/servers)
